Pakistan import trend for the polypropylene market showed a growth rate of 6.57% from 2023 to 2024,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.02% from 2020 to 2024. This increase can be attributed to the country`s expanding industrial sector and rising demand for polypropylene products.

The Polypropylene market in Pakistan is projected to grow at a growing growth rate of 7.47% by 2027, highlighting the country's increasing focus on advanced technologies within the Asia region, where China holds the dominant position, followed closely by India, Japan, Australia and South Korea, shaping overall regional demand.

The Polypropylene Market in Pakistan is significant for the plastic industry, with applications spanning packaging, automotive, textiles, and consumer goods. Polypropylene is valued for its versatility, durability, and chemical resistance, making it a preferred material for various products.
The Pakistan polypropylene market is experiencing growth due to the increasing demand from packaging, automotive, construction, and consumer goods industries. Polypropylene is a versatile thermoplastic polymer known for its excellent chemical resistance, durability, and cost-effectiveness, making it a preferred material in various applications. The growing population, urbanization, and rising disposable incomes in Pakistan are driving the demand for packaged goods, automobiles, and construction materials, thereby fueling the growth of the polypropylene market in the country. Moreover, technological advancements in polypropylene production processes and the development of new application areas are further boosting market expansion.
The polypropylene market in Pakistan is challenged by the high cost of raw materials and production, with a heavy reliance on imports. This dependency makes the market vulnerable to international price fluctuations and supply chain disruptions. Additionally, local manufacturers face stiff competition from well-established international companies that can offer more cost-effective and technologically advanced products. There is also a need for continuous innovation and development to meet the diverse demands of various end-use industries, requiring significant investment in research and development.
In Pakistan, the government has implemented policies to support the polypropylene market, which is vital for various industries such as packaging, textiles, and automotive. These policies include investment promotion initiatives, infrastructure development projects, and trade facilitation measures to enhance the competitiveness of the domestic polypropylene industry. Moreover, the government has introduced regulations to ensure product quality, environmental sustainability, and safety standards in the production and usage of polypropylene materials.
